Iwant to submit my mutual fund identity number where can i do it in fort mumbai?


mutual fund identification is must for trading in mf ihave application form but do not know where to submit it istay in fort mumbai

MIN is no longer required as per clarifications given by SEBI and ministry of finance as well. Only PAN card/number is required. It means the Mutual Fund Identity Number is now redundant. If u have taken one u can keep it with u as a sovinuer. It has no practical value now and does not have to be returned to anyone
